Searching for coupons online, but not sure where to look or who to trust? Here's a round-up of the best online coupon sources:

Visit Manufacturer Websites

Make a list of all of the products that appear in your pantry and medicine cabinet on a regular basis. Then, head to each manufacturer's website in search of coupons. Many companies have coupons that you can print right off of their site, while others will reward you with coupons, if you sign up to receive their e-newsletter.

Go to the Coupon Companies

You know those SmartSource and RedPlum coupons that you get in your Sunday paper? Well, you can now get those same coupons online!

Tip: Cut out your favorite coupons from the newspaper. Then, go online to print out additional copies.

Sign Up for Upromise.com

Need a reason to save for college? Well, here it is: sign up for upromise.com; select coupons to load onto your grocery and drug store cards; and the money that you save will be deposited directly into your college savings account.

Check Grocery Store Websites

Grocery stores are making it easier than ever to coupon. Visit the website of your favorite grocery store, and you're likely to find loads of coupons to print or download.

Look on Drug Store Websites

Grocery stores aren't the only ones to get onboard with the printable coupon craze. Visit drug store websites, and you'll find page after page of clip-and-print coupons to choose from.

Sign Up for Cellfire

Have a cell phone? Then, get your coupons to go. Sign up for Cellfire, and you can load coupons directly to your cell phone (or grocery card).

Sign Up for P&G eSaver

Want to get your hands on more Procter and Gamble coupons? Sign up for the P&G eSaver program, and you can add their coupons to your grocery card too!
